IFC Proposes Strategic Solutions to Enhance Pakistan Railways

Islamabad: In a decisive move to rejuvenate Pakistan Railways, Minister of State for Railways Bilal Azhar Kayani has reaffirmed the government’s dedication to modernizing the national rail network. During discussions with a delegation from the International Finance Corporation (IFC), led by Global Director Linda Rudo Munyengeterwa, the minister underscored the significant role the railways could play in fostering economic growth and enhancing regional connectivity.

Kayani highlighted the necessity of international collaboration to harness the expertise and investment needed to transform the railway sector. He emphasized creating an environment conducive to both private and public sector contributions to develop a rail system that serves the collective interest.

Munyengeterwa echoed the minister’s sentiments, stressing the potential of a robust railway infrastructure in shaping Pakistan’s economic trajectory. She confirmed IFC’s readiness to provide technical expertise, advisory services, and investment solutions to support the modernization efforts, thereby aligning with the government’s vision for an improved rail network.

This collaboration marks a strategic step towards leveraging international support to revitalize Pakistan’s railways, aiming for sustainable development and economic integration.
